I loved Limitless. The movie I mean. With all of the movies becoming TV series lately (Dominion, Scream, Minority Report, etc.), this is probably the one I had the highest expectations for. I really enjoyed the pilot, but it seems to be heading in a kind of formulaic direction. The outcast with powers or a unique perspective helping out the local law enforcement is a somewhat milked idea. Don’t get me wrong, some of these shows are gold, and though it is tried, it is also true. It’s a formula that works and this one seems to be joining the pack. If they keep the science interesting, it’ll probably run for a while.

NZT is honestly my dream drug. I definitely wish it was real, especially if they have the shot Brian received in this episode. I could see myself getting so much done in my hectic life. But anyway, Jennifer Carpenter and Jake McDorman are selling it as the leads and seeing Bradley Cooper return as Senator Eddie Morra was awesome. The world they’re in is very consistent with that of the movie and it’s very enjoyable.

The discovery and journey for more NZT was very well written. It was fairly similar to Eddie’s journey in the movie, but a little more personally involved. I actually didn’t see the small twist coming when he discovered who killed his old friend. Brian is a good guy and he made his mission saving his father, character motivations are always a key part of entertainment, and everything made sense here. Let’s keep things going and vary it up a bit in future episodes. Please don’t get shuffled in the pile Limitless.
